一个基于机器学习的框架,用于预后预测和瘤微环境特征局部先进的宫癌与并发的化学放射治疗

概括
通过新的深度学习模型 (DeepMR-LACC) 和放射性蛋白质学,改善了局部晚期宫癌 (LACC) 的准确预后. 这种方法有助于个性化治疗,并揭示瘤微环境的洞察力.

背景情况:
- 对于局部晚期宫癌 (LACC) 后并发化疗放射治疗 (CCRT) 的准确预后预测对于个性化治疗至关重要.
- 目前对LACC的预后因素需要加强,以改善患者分层.
研究的目的:
- 开发一个多任务预后模型 (DeepMR-LACC),使用深度学习对LACC的治疗前MRI扫描进行深度学习.
- 调查放射性-表型关联和放射性蛋白质学,以改善LACC患者的风险分层.
主要方法:
- 开发了一个深度学习模型 (DeepMR-LACC),使用T2加权的MRI来预测无进展生存 (PFS) 和整体生存 (OS).
- 在宫活检中进行了蛋白质组学分析,以表征瘤微环境,并使基于放射蛋白质组学的风险分层成为可能.
- 该模型的性能在培训,内部测试和外部测试队列中进行了评估,并与临床风险因素进行了比较.
主要成果:
- DeepMR-LACC模型表现出强大的预后性能,PFS和OS的C指数在整个队列中从0.65到0.87不等.
- 该模型有效地将LACC患者分为高风险和低风险组,优于现有的临床因素.
- 蛋白质组分析显示,高风险组中的瘤微环境具有免疫抑制作用,基于放射性蛋白质组的分层显示出更高的预后准确性 (PFS和OS的C指数为0.85).
结论:
- 深度MR-LACC模型为用CCRT治疗的LACC患者提供了准确的预后预测.
- 基于放射性蛋白质组学的风险分层提供了优越的预后性能,与单独的深度学习模型相比.
- 这种综合方法增强了瘤微环境的特征,支持LACC的个性化长期管理策略.

The Tumor Microenvironment
7.6K
Every normal cell or tissue is embedded in a complex local environment called stroma, consisting of different cell types, a basal membrane, and blood vessels. As normal cells mutate and develop into cancer cells, their local environment also changes to allow cancer progression. The tumor microenvironment (TME) consists of a complex cellular matrix of stromal cells and the developing tumor. Cancer Survival Analysis
629
Cancer survival analysis focuses on quantifying and interpreting the time from a key starting point, such as diagnosis or the initiation of treatment, to a specific endpoint, such as remission or death. This analysis provides critical insights into treatment effectiveness and factors that influence patient outcomes, helping to shape clinical decisions and guide prognostic evaluations.
